The Brain
Brain Development+How our brains develop tends to be opposite of our education system and some parent expectations…
+The human brain develops from the back to front…the education system and sometimes parenting is largely set up as front to back…
+Educators and other adults have the ability to off set some of this opposition simply by the way they interact with children…

The Brain and Attention
+It is IMPOSSIBLE to “not pay attention”; the brain is ALWAYS paying attention
+Attention is selective
+Sustained attention to something you can’t understand is not only boring, but almost impossible…(think about instructional practices in classrooms)…human beings do not attend to or store meaningless information
The Brain and Emotion
+Emotion drives attention and attention drives
learning and memory

The Brain and Stress
+Anxiety increases cognitive rigidity (my term:
Stress makes you stupid)
+Stressed adults = stressed children

Function vs. Form
+Addressing the FORM is only temporary
+Addressing the FUNCTION is life changing
+The function of the behavior is the motivation behind it or what is maintaining it…it is the answer to the question “WHY?”
+The form of the behavior is the topography: what does it look like, sound like, how intense is it, how long does it last, how often does it occur
**IMPORTANT – A behavior can have multiple functions
It’s All About the Data
Data
Data MUST be:
Simple – easy, quick, and to the point
Accurate – done with fidelity, honesty, and integrity
Collect baseline data for minimum of 3 weeks
(consider time of year also)
Use data to make hypothesis on the FUNCTION of the
behavior (Why is the student doing what they are doing?)

Behavior Explained…Socially Mediated Positive
(External)
*Someone else provides something that is preferred
Socially Mediated Negative (External)
*Someone else removes a non-preferred or aversive
Automatic Positive (Internal)
*You provide something that is preferred
Automatic Negative (Internal)
*You remove a non-preferred or aversive
